PH FOR SHELF STABLE HOT SAUCE. Ideally, a pH measurement of 3.4 creates a sufficiently acidic environment to prevent bacteria from growing. WebOct 30, 2024 · 1 to 2 years. The periods above are general estimates. Its actual shelf life depends on the formulation, preparation method, and storage conditions. WebApr 14, 2024 · It is feasible to store the homemade hot sauce in the refrigerator for up to three months at a time. Refrigeration significantly increases the shelf life of spicy sauce by slowing the pace at which it oxidizes (oxidation reaction rate). WebJun 21, 2024 · A standard bottle of hot sauce has a shelf life of 2 to 3 years and can easily be kept for many months after the expiration date is listed on the label. Once the bottle is opened, it will retain its quality for at least 6 months if maintained at room temperature and for more than a year if refrigerated after opening.

WebFeb 22, 2024 · However, they advise customers to consume the product 2 years within its manufactured date. Tapatio, like other sauces, does go bad after a while. An unopened bottle of Tapatio hot sauce has a shelf-life of up to two years. An opened bottle, on the other hand, can last for about 3-6 months.
